Kazi Patti is a village situated in Burhanpur tehsil of Azamgarh district in Uttar Pradesh. As per the Population Census 2011, there are a total of 82 families residing in the village Kazi Patti. The total population of Kazi Patti is 496 out of which 257 are males and 239 are females thus the Average Sex Ratio of Kazi Patti is 930.

The population of Children aged 0-6 years in Kazi Patti village is 72 which is 15% of the total population. There are 37 male children and 35 female children between the age 0-6 years. Thus as per the Census 2011 the Child Sex Ratio of Kazi Patti is 946 which is greater than Average Sex Ratio (930) of Kazi Patti village.

As per the Census 2011, the literacy rate of Kazi Patti is 71%. Thus Kazi Patti village has a higher literacy rate compared to 60.1% of Azamgarh district. The male literacy rate is 82.73% and the female literacy rate is 58.33% in Kazi Patti village.

Working Population as per Census 2011

In Kazi Patti village out of total population, 132 were engaged in work activities. 16.7% of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 83.3% were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 132 workers engaged in Main Work, 0 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 1 were Agricultural labourers.
